HISTORY

It is with joy that the Faculty of Psychology at PUC Minas presents the Pretextos to the academic community. Or rather, it re-presents, therefore, the periodical, secure, was an instrument of record and archiving of materials made for the Journey of the Clinic of the Department of Psychology at PUC Minas, When the course was still restricted to the Coração Eucarístico campus. The texts were typed and circulated internally. Today, the journal is rescued and its scope of publication has been expanded: the publication aims to encourage the scientific dissemination of studies developed in the area of ​​Psychology by students, teachers, professionals and researchers from PUC Minas or any other Higher Education Institution.

Pretextos gathers articles from internship practices, scientific initiation and university extension and course completion research (monograph). Attention is given to the texts available during or as a result of the graduation process, since the Faculty of Psychology at PUC Minas already has Psicologia em Revista[1], a journal under the care of the Graduate Program in Psychology and that although it may also include in its scope the productions of undergraduate students, it does not have these as a preferred audience.

Texts in Portuguese or Spanish can be published.

 

Mission

Pretextos, a journal of the Faculty of Psychology of the Pontifical Catholic University of Minas Gerais (PUC Minas), aims to encourage the scientific dissemination of studies developed by undergraduate students in Psychology at PUC Minas and other Higher Education Institutions. The publication brings together texts from internship, extension, scientific initiation and course completion (monograph) produced during graduation, also contemplating Psychology articles from the postgraduate context, as well as writings prepared by professors and researchers in the area. It is a biannual journal that offers free / open access to its content, following the principle that making scientific material available free of charge provides greater democratization of knowledge. It is noteworthy, however, that the opinions expressed in the articles are the sole responsibility of their author (s). Texts in Portuguese or Spanish can be published. ISSN: 2448-0738.

Submission policy

Due to the large number of contributions received for the editions already published, the period for submitting articles will be opened only once a year (according to the schedule that will be released soon). However, since it is a biannual journal, after evaluation, part of the works received will be selected to compose the volume for the first semester (January / June) of the following year, and others will be separated for the number for the second semester (July / December) of the same year. An acceptance letter is sent to the authors certifying the approval of their contribution.

 

Section policy / scope

Articles originating from works developed during graduation will be accepted, as a result of theoretical-conceptual and methodological reflections, with or without analysis of empirical data, produced from monographs (course completion works) and experiences of scientific initiation, internship or extension. There will also be articles on Psychology produced by students from the Postgraduate courses at PUC Minas and other Higher Education Institutions, and by professors and researchers in the field. Reviews and abstracts of dissertations and theses are also published, according to specific guidelines for these types of productions.

Peer review – Double Blind Review

The articles and reviews received will be sent to ad hoc reviewers, so that each production will undergo at least two evaluations. The Editorial Team is in charge of preserving the identities of authors and reviewers during the process - Double Blind Review. The opinion prepared by the evaluators follows criteria stipulated by the editors of the magazine, and must be sent by them to the Editorial Team within a maximum of thirty days. All authors will receive feedback on the submission of their work (accepted, accepted with modifications, rejected).

LOCKSS / secure filing

Pretextos uses the LOCKSS (Lots of Copies Keep Stuff Safe) to ensure safe and permanent archiving of your cache. It is free software developed by the Stanford University Library, which allows preserving online magazines chosen by scanning their pages for newly published content and archiving it. Each file is continuously validated against copies from other libraries. In case the content is corrupted or lost, the copies are used for restoration.
